usernotnull / tall-toasts

A Toast notification library for the Laravel TALL stack. You can push notifications from the backend or frontend to render customizable toasts with almost zero footprint on the published CSS/JS 🔥🚀

Changelog for v3.27.0

  • docs: cleanup old mention of --show-progress=estimating in docs (#7287)
  • DX: add Composer script for applying CS fixes in parallel (#7274)
  • feat: Clone PER-CS1.0 to PER-CS2.0 to prepare for adding new rules (#7249)
  • feat: Introduce LongToShorthandOperatorFixer (#7295)
  • feat: Mark PER-CS v1 as deprecated (#7283)
  • feat: Move single_line_empty_body to @PER-CS2.0 (#7282)
  • fix: Priorities for fixers related to curly braces, empty lines and trailing whitespace (#7296)
  • fix: OrderedTraitsFixer - better support for multiple traits in one use statement (#7289)
